Deadline is reporting from the Cannes Film Festival that Will Packer will be producing via his Will Packer Productions banner Adrian Lyne’s Silence, starring Michael Douglas and Halle Berry.
Douglas starred on Lyne’s 1987 Fatal Attraction, which received six Academy Award nominations, including Best Picture and Best Actress for co-star Glen Close.
Adapted by Billy Ray based on the bestselling 2013 A.S.A. Harrison novel, the story set in Chicago during a snow-covered Christmas in the 1960s, when for John Carpenter, the holiday spirit is broken by violence throughout the city, and an unlikely stranger named Silence saves his life during a deadly riot. The story will leave you questioning how far you would go to protect the ones you love.
Lotus Entertainment has come aboard to sell international rights at the Cannes film market. Packer will produce with Will Packer Productions head of motion pictures James Lopez, and with Lyne. Jim Seibel, Bill Johnson, Ara Keshishian and Angus Sutherland of Lotus are serving as executive producers.
This is the second project that Berry has committed to from Cannes. She’s attached to star in Turkish-French writer/director Deniz Gamze Ergüven’s English-language feature film debut with “Kings,” a drama set during the 1992 Los Angeles riots.
